Becky, Gina, Claire, Nicole and I had the Five Take theme of polka dots this week. I was super excited about it because I love the trend, but then I looked in my closet and I only had 3 items: a purse, a cardigan, and a swimsuit (I must not love itthat much, huh?). Ruling the swimsuit out for obvious reasons, I had to choose between the purse and cardigan, and since I enjoy polka dots in small, purposeful pieces of a look, I decided on the purse.
I went for a relatively simple outfit with a pop of polka dots and chain details in my accessories. I loved the combination of the textured stripes with the printed polka dots, and FOR ONCE my skirt looks the right length in pictures — hooray! I’m really in love with this skirt, and I’m glad I found it on eBay since I had let it slip by on ASOS. It’s thick and long enough that I don’t have to worry about it riding up when I sit down or bend over, and it has a lovely deep red wine color.
